- CHECK THE ASD RELAY FOR PROPER OPERATION
- Ignition off.
- Install a known good relay in place of the ASD Relay.
- Turn the ignition on.
- With the scan tool, erase DTCs in the PCM.
- Perform several ignition key cycles, pausing for at least one minute between each cycle.
- Turn the ignition on.
- With the scan tool, select View DTCs.
Did the DTC return?
Yes
- Go To 3
No
- Repair complete.
- Perform the POWERTRAIN VERIFICATION TEST. Refer to 3.0L, POWERTRAIN VERIFICATION TEST .
- CHECK FOR THE (K51) ASD RELAY CONTROL CIRCUIT FOR AN INTERMITTENT OPEN
- Ignition off.
- Remove the ASD Relay.
- Disconnect the PCM C1 harness connector.
- Measure the resistance of the ASD Relay Control circuit while wiggling the wiring harness and connectors between the PCM and the ASD Relay connector.
Did the resistance go above 5.0 Ohms at any time while wiggling the wiring harness and connectors?
Yes
- Repair the ASD Relay Control circuit for an intermittent open.
- Perform the POWERTRAIN VERIFICATION TEST. Refer to 3.0L, POWERTRAIN VERIFICATION TEST .
No
- Go To 4

- CHECK RELATED HARNESS CONNECTIONS
- Disconnect all PCM harness connectors.
- Disconnect all related in-line harness connections (if equipped).
- Disconnect the related component harness connectors.
- Inspect harness connectors, component connectors, and all male and female terminals for the following conditions:
- Proper connector installation.
- Damaged connector locks.
- Corrosion.
- Other signs of water intrusion.
- Weather seal damage (if equipped).
- Bent terminals.
- Overheating due to a poor connection (terminal may be discolored due to excessive current draw).
- Terminals that have been pushed back into the connector cavity.
- Check for spread terminals and verify proper terminal tension.
Repair any conditions that are found.
- Connect all PCM harness connectors. Be certain that all harness connectors are fully seated and the connector locks are fully engaged.
- Connect all in-line harness connectors (if equipped). Be certain that all connectors are fully seated and the connector locks are fully engaged.
- Connect all related component harness connectors. Be certain that all connectors are fully seated and the connector locks are fully engaged.
- With the scan tool, erase DTCs.
- Test drive or operate the vehicle in accordance with the when monitored and set conditions.
- With the scan tool, read DTCs.
Did the DTC return?
Yes
- Replace and program the Powertrain Control Module (PCM) in accordance with the Service Information.
- Perform the POWERTRAIN VERIFICATION TEST. Refer to 3.0L, POWERTRAIN VERIFICATION TEST .
No
- The wiring or poor connection problem has been repaired.
- Perform the POWERTRAIN VERIFICATION TEST. Refer to 3.0L, POWERTRAIN VERIFICATION TEST .
